Output 286242b5996d9ac24c17dbc474dd0617e4d5efa8c43b1af8804b4fb31dc211ac:2

value
84685573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ae52d78e735db71cde7f606697dd526bb9eb027 OP_EQUAL
address
3Fp2XdGyyLJRkMS7LDyH2xiWyh1YtwEBvi
transaction
286242b5996d9ac24c17dbc474dd0617e4d5efa8c43b1af8804b4fb31dc211ac
confirmations
405446
spent
true